(57) [Summary] [Purpose] To make it possible to smoothly discharge the cleaning water etc. sprinkled inside the entrance to the outside of the entrance. [Structure] A drainage communication frame 10 that covers the inside and outside of the entrance door 3 is exposed and buried on the surface of the entrance, and an inner frame 11 located inside the entrance and an outer frame 12 located outside the entrance are partitioned. To do. The inner frame 11 communicates with the water collecting gutter 14 for collecting water existing inside the entrance, and the outer frame 12 communicates with the water collecting gutter 14.
Drain gutter 1 that is inclined to guide it to a designated drainage location
Distribute 7 respectively.

Description

【考案の詳細な説明】[Detailed description of the device]

【0001】[0001]

【産業上の利用分野】[Industrial applications]

この考案は、主として、一般家屋における玄関内の三和土部分に散水された清 掃用の洗浄水等を玄関外部に排水できるようにした玄関の排水装置に関する。 The present invention mainly relates to a drainage device for an entrance, which is capable of discharging the cleaning water for cleaning, which is sprayed on the Sanwa soil in the entrance of a general house, to the outside of the entrance.

【0002】[0002]

【従来の技術】[Prior Art]

従来、玄関内の三和土は、住居者の出入り、訪問者の迎え等のための家屋外部 との出入りに際する履物の脱着その他に便利となるよう、その表面は堅牢な素材 によって構成されている。特に、外部と直接に連絡される場所であるから、外部 の気候、外部からの侵入物の影響等に十分に絶え得るように、コンクリートモル タル仕上げであったり、タイル張り仕上げであったりしている。そして、その清 掃に際しては、外部から侵入した細かい塵埃その他をも十分に除去すべく、散水 してそれらと共に外部に排水、廃棄し、清浄なものとして例えば訪問者に対する 好印象を与えるようにしている。 Traditionally, the surface of Sanwa soil in the entrance has been constructed of a robust material so that it is convenient for putting on and taking off footwear when going in and out of the house for the purpose of entering and leaving residents and welcoming visitors. ing. In particular, since it is a place that is directly contacted with the outside, concrete mortar finish or tile finish is used so as to be able to sufficiently withstand the external climate and the influence of intruders from the outside. There is. During the cleaning, in order to sufficiently remove fine dust and other foreign substances that have entered from the outside, water is sprayed and drained to the outside together with them, and discarded so that it gives a good impression to visitors, for example. There is.

【0003】[0003]

【考案が解決しようとする課題】[Problems to be solved by the device]

ところが、このように、玄関内に散水し、清掃する場合に、散水後の洗浄水を 玄関外部に排水するのは簡単ではなく、そのまま、玄関内に滞留し、これらを雑 巾等で拭き取るとしても、極めて面倒である。しかも、そのまま玄関内部で滞留 させたままとしておくと、履物等の脱着に際し不便であり、場合によっては衣服 を汚損し、また、滑ったり、転んでしまったりすることもあった。 However, in this way, when water is sprinkled inside the entrance for cleaning, it is not easy to drain the washing water after sprinkling to the outside of the entrance, and it is possible to stay in the entrance as it is and wipe it off with a cloth etc. Is extremely troublesome. Moreover, if they are left inside the entrance as they are, it may be inconvenient when putting on and taking off footwear, and in some cases they may stain clothes or slip or fall.

【0004】 そこで、この考案は、叙上のような従来存した諸事情に鑑み案出されたもので 、玄関内の三和土等を清掃するために散水した洗浄水等を玄関外部に簡単に排水 できるようにした玄関の排水装置を提供することを目的とする。Therefore, the present invention has been devised in consideration of various existing conditions such as the above, and it is easy to sprinkle wash water sprinkled to clean Sanwa soil and the like inside the entrance to the outside of the entrance. It is an object of the present invention to provide a drainage device at the entrance that allows drainage to the outside.

【0006】[0006]

【作用】[Action]

この考案に係る玄関の排水装置にあって、排水連通枠は、玄関ドアにおける閉 塞部分位置の内外に亙って設置されていて、玄関内部に配装位置された内枠部内 の集水樋は、例えば玄関内部で清掃のために散水された洗浄水等を集水する。 この集水された洗浄水等は、集水樋と排水樋とを連通させている連通路によっ て集水樋から排水樋へ案内され、排水樋は、所定の排水場所である外部に洗浄水 等を排水する。 In the entrance drainage device according to the present invention, the drainage communication frame is installed inside and outside the closed position of the entrance door, and the water collecting gutter in the inner frame part installed inside the entrance. Collects cleaning water sprinkled for cleaning inside the entrance, for example. The collected cleaning water is guided from the water collecting gutter to the drainage gutter by a communication passage that connects the water collecting gutter and the drainage gutter, and the drainage gutter is washed outside at a predetermined drainage place. Drain water etc.

【0007】[0007]

【実施例】【Example】

以下、図面を参照してこの考案の一実施例を説明するに、図において示される 符号1は、例えば一般家屋の建築物における玄関部分の基礎であり、この基礎1 上に、コンクリートモルタル、タイル等の玄関に適する表面仕上げ材2が塗り込 められ、また、貼着される等して施されている。 An embodiment of the present invention will be described below with reference to the drawings. Reference numeral 1 shown in the drawings is, for example, a foundation of a front door portion in a building of a general house, and concrete mortar and tiles are provided on the foundation 1. The surface finishing material 2 suitable for the entrance such as is applied and applied by being attached.

【0008】 玄関部分には、内外を仕切り、また、出入りするために開閉される玄関ドア3 が設けられており、図示にあっての玄関ドア3は、一側縁が蝶番部材によってド ア枠に支持されている開き戸構造のものとしてある。そして、この玄関ドア3下 端には、所定の閉塞位置にあるとき、玄関ドア3の下端面から玄関部分上面にま で到達するように、玄関ドア3下端から突出する気密材4が出没自在に組み込ま れている。この気密材4は、玄関ドア3の開閉作動に連繋して自動的に、あるい は手動操作によって昇降されるもので、玄関ドア3が開放状態にあるときは玄関 ドア3内に上昇して収納され、閉塞状態にあるときは玄関ドア3から突出して玄 関ドア3下端と玄関部分上面との7乃至8mm程度の間隙を閉塞するようになっ ている。At the entrance, there is provided an entrance door 3 for partitioning the inside and outside and opening and closing for entrance and exit. The entrance door 3 shown in the figure has a door frame with a hinge member at one side edge. It has a hinged door structure supported by. At the lower end of the front door 3, the airtight material 4 protruding from the lower end of the front door 3 can freely appear and disappear so that the lower end surface of the front door 3 reaches the upper surface of the front door at a predetermined closed position. Built into. This airtight material 4 is automatically moved up or down by being linked with the opening / closing operation of the entrance door 3 or by manual operation. When the entrance door 3 is in an open state, it rises into the entrance door 3. When it is stored and is in a closed state, it projects from the entrance door 3 to close a gap of about 7 to 8 mm between the lower end of the entrance door 3 and the upper surface of the entrance portion.

【0009】 また、玄関部分上面、例えば前記表面仕上げ材2には、玄関ドア3における閉 塞位置で、その内外を連通させる上部開口の排水連通枠10が玄関内外に亙って 、その上部開口が露出された状態で埋め込み状に設けられている。 すなわち、この排水連通枠10は、玄関内側に配される内枠部11と、玄関外 側に配される外枠部12とから成り、例えば開口縁部に補強リブを一体に連設し た状態でアルミニウム材等によって形成されている。そして、内枠部11には、 玄関内部に散水された洗浄水等を集水する集水樋14を、外枠部12には、集水 樋14に連通し、所定の排水場所に案内させるよう傾斜している排水樋17を夫 々配装してある。A drainage communication frame 10 having an upper opening that communicates the inside and outside of the entrance door 3 with the upper surface of the entrance, for example, the surface finish material 2 at the closed position of the entrance door 3, extends inside and outside the entrance. It is embedded in the exposed state. That is, the drainage communication frame 10 is composed of an inner frame portion 11 arranged inside the entrance and an outer frame portion 12 arranged outside the entrance. For example, reinforcing ribs are integrally connected to the opening edge portion. In the state, it is formed of an aluminum material or the like. Then, the inner frame part 11 communicates with a water collecting gutter 14 for collecting washing water sprinkled inside the entrance, and the outer frame part 12 communicates with the water collecting gutter 14 to guide it to a predetermined drainage place. The drain gutters 17 that are inclined like this are installed respectively.

【0010】 内枠部11自体は、図1に示すように、玄関部分における出入口内側の左右に 沿った長い開口を有する比較的浅いボックス状に形成され、また、外枠部12自 体は、同じく玄関部分における出入口外側の左右に沿った長い開口を有する比較 的深いボックス状に形成されており、これら11,12の間には、閉塞状態とな った玄関ドア3における気密材4下方に位置する仕切り壁13が設けられている 。As shown in FIG. 1, the inner frame portion 11 itself is formed in a relatively shallow box shape having long openings along the left and right inside the entrance and exit at the entrance portion, and the outer frame portion 12 itself is Similarly, it is formed in a comparatively deep box shape having a long opening along the left and right outside the entrance at the entrance, and between these 11 and 12, below the airtight material 4 on the closed entrance door 3. The partition wall 13 located is provided.

【0011】 集水樋14は、その開口を内枠部11の開口とほぼ一致させておいて、内部ネ ット材15等によって覆ってあり、玄関内部に散水された洗浄水等を適当に濾過 し、集水樋14自体、後述する連通路19その他の目詰まり等を防止する。図示 にあって、このネット材15によって覆われた集水樋14の開口は、玄関ドア3 が閉塞された状態にあって、これによって隠蔽されるように、玄関ドア3直下に 位置するように配装されている。また、内枠部11の玄関内側部分における開口 は、化粧材16によって覆われていて、玄関ドア3が閉塞状態にあるときの内枠 部11の開口部分を隠蔽化粧しているようにしてある。もとより、内枠部11の 幅員を狭くし、閉塞状態にある玄関ドア3の内側面位置に対応させるようにする ことで、この化粧材16を省略することができる。The water collecting trough 14 has its opening substantially aligned with the opening of the inner frame portion 11 and is covered with an internal net material 15 or the like, so that the washing water sprinkled inside the entrance can be properly sprayed. It is filtered to prevent clogging of the water collecting gutter 14 itself, the communication passage 19 described later, and the like. As shown in the drawing, the opening of the water collecting trough 14 covered with the net material 15 is located immediately below the entrance door 3 so that the entrance door 3 is closed and covered by the entrance door 3. It is distributed. Further, the opening at the inside of the entrance of the inner frame 11 is covered with the decorative material 16 so that the opening of the inner frame 11 when the entrance door 3 is closed is covered. .. Of course, the decorative material 16 can be omitted by narrowing the width of the inner frame portion 11 so as to correspond to the inner side surface position of the entrance door 3 in the closed state.

【0012】 一方、排水樋17は、排水場所に直接に連通する部位が最も低くなるような水 勾配の傾斜構造のものとしてあり、その開口を外枠部12の開口とほぼ一致させ ておいて、外部ネット材18等によって覆ってあり、玄関外部で降雨する雨水、 散水された洗浄水等を適当に濾過し、排水管その他の目詰まり等を防止する。こ の排水樋17は、前記仕切り壁13に開穿した孔状あるいは貫挿したパイプ状の 適数の連通路19等によって集水樋14に連通されており、集水樋14によって 集水された玄関内部の洗浄水等を連通路19を経て排水樋17内に案内するよう な水勾配が付されている。On the other hand, the drain gutter 17 has an inclined structure with a water gradient so that the portion directly communicating with the drainage place becomes the lowest, and its opening is made to substantially coincide with the opening of the outer frame portion 12. It is covered with an external net material 18 and the like, and properly filters rainwater that rains outside the entrance, sprinkled washing water, etc. to prevent drainage pipes and other clogging. The drainage gutter 17 is communicated with the water collection gutter 14 by a suitable number of communication passages 19 having a hole shape or a pipe shape penetrating the partition wall 13, and the water is collected by the water collection gutter 14. There is a water gradient so that the washing water inside the entrance can be guided into the drain gutter 17 through the communication passage 19.

【0013】 なお、この連通路19は、その径を可能な限り小さいものとし、また、少なく して、玄関外における風雨が玄関内に吹き込まないように配慮しておく。 また、集水樋14開口の内部ネット材15、排水樋17開口の外部ネット材1 8上面には、これらを被装するすのこ状、格子状の覆い材20を載置配装して人 の出入りその他に際する内部ネット材15、外部ネット材18等の損傷その他を 防止するようにしてある。この覆い材20は、玄関の内外部で各別に被装するも 、全体をまとめて被装するようにするもいずれであっても差支えない。The diameter of the communication passage 19 should be as small as possible, and should be reduced so that wind and rain outside the entrance will not be blown into the entrance. Further, on the upper surface of the inner net material 15 with the opening of the water collecting gutter 14 and the outer net material 18 with the opening of the drainage gutter 17, sludge-like and grid-like covering materials 20 for covering these are placed and arranged so that the human The inner net material 15, the outer net material 18, etc. are prevented from being damaged when entering or leaving. It does not matter whether the covering material 20 is individually covered inside or outside the entrance, or the covering material is collectively covered.

【0014】 次にこれが使用の一例を説明するに、玄関部分の施工構築に際し、玄関ドア3 における閉塞部分位置の内外に亙って排水連通枠10を、例えば表面仕上げ材2 表面に露出するようにして埋設し、内枠部11を玄関内側に、外枠部12を玄関 外側に夫々位置させる。内枠部11内に配装された集水樋14は、例えば玄関内 部で清掃のために散水された洗浄水等を集水し、連通路19を経て排水樋17に 案内し、外部に排水する。Next, this will be described as an example of use. At the time of constructing and constructing the entrance portion, the drainage communication frame 10 is exposed inside and outside the position of the closed portion of the entrance door 3, for example, on the surface finishing material 2. The inner frame portion 11 is located inside the entrance, and the outer frame portion 12 is located outside the entrance. The water collecting gutter 14 arranged in the inner frame part 11 collects, for example, cleaning water sprinkled for cleaning at the inside of the entrance, and guides it to the drain gutter 17 via the communication passage 19 to the outside. Drain.

【0015】 このとき、玄関内部に配装の内部ネット材15は、玄関内の塵埃その他を捕捉 濾過し、洗浄水のみを集水樋14内に案内する。また、玄関外部に配装の外部ネ ット材18は、玄関外の風雨による塵埃その他の排水樋17内への侵入を防止し 、排水樋17内を清浄状態に維持するのに役立つ。 また、覆い材20、更には内部ネット材15、外部ネット材18を取り外し、 集水樋14、排水樋17内部を清掃するとよい。At this time, the internal net material 15 arranged inside the entrance traps and filters dust and the like in the entrance, and guides only the washing water into the water collecting trough 14. Further, the external net material 18 arranged outside the entrance prevents dust and other dust from entering the drain gutter 17 due to wind and rain outside the entrance, and helps maintain the inside of the drain gutter 17 in a clean state. Further, it is preferable to remove the covering material 20, and further the inner net material 15 and the outer net material 18, and clean the inside of the water collecting gutter 14 and the drain gutter 17.

【0016】[0016]

【考案の効果】[Effect of the device]

この考案は以上のように構成されており、これがため、例えば一般家屋におけ る玄関内部である三和土部分に散水された清掃用の洗浄水等を外部に円滑に排水 でき、玄関内部を常時清浄に維持でき、また、玄関内に洗浄水等がそのまま残ら ないから、これによって滑ったり、転んだりすることがなく、安全でもある。 The present invention is configured as described above, and therefore, for example, washing water for cleaning sprinkled on Sanwa soil, which is the inside of the entrance of a general house, can be smoothly drained to the outside, and the inside of the entrance can be drained smoothly. It can be kept clean at all times, and since there is no residual cleaning water in the entrance, it is safe as it does not slip or fall.

【0017】 すなわち、これは、この考案が、玄関ドアの内外部に亙って玄関部分の表面に 露出埋設した排水連通枠に、玄関内外部夫々に位置する内枠部、外枠部を区画形 成し、内枠部には集水樋を、外枠部には集水樋に連通し、排水案内させる傾斜し た排水樋を夫々配装したからであり、これによって、玄関内部に存する水等を集 水樋、連通路、排水樋を経て所定の排水場所に排水できるものである。That is, according to the present invention, the drainage communication frame exposed and buried on the surface of the entrance part inside and outside the entrance door is divided into an inner frame part and an outer frame part located inside and outside the entrance, respectively. This is because the inner girders are equipped with water collecting gutters, and the outer frame are connected to the water collecting gutters and sloped drain gutters for guiding drainage. Water can be drained to a designated drainage place through a water collecting gutter, a communication passage, and a drain gutter.

【0018】 そればかりでなく、玄関外部の集水樋の上部開口は、玄関外部を清掃する洗浄 水、更には降雨する雨水等を排水させるためにも利用でき、玄関内外で水等を滞 留させることがなく、人の出入りを容易にするものである。 更には、排水樋と集水樋とを連通させている連通路の数を可能な限り少なくし 、また、十分に小径にすることで、玄関外における風雨は、玄関内に浸入せず、 特に、集水樋の開口位置を、閉塞状態にある玄関ドアの直下に位置するようにし ておくことで、その浸入を一層阻止することができる。Not only that, but the upper opening of the water collecting gutter outside the entrance can also be used for draining cleaning water for cleaning the outside of the entrance, and rainwater that rains, and retains water inside and outside the entrance. It makes it easy for people to come in and out without making it happen. Furthermore, by minimizing the number of communication passages that connect the drainage gutter and the water collection gutter as much as possible, and by making the diameter sufficiently small, wind and rain outside the entrance will not enter the entrance, The intrusion of the water collecting trough can be further prevented by setting the opening position of the water collecting trough just below the closed entrance door.
